How Tesla Is Making It Even Longer - Official Details

How Tesla Is Making It Even Longer - Official Details

Tesla Motors is updating its Model S electric car to help ease drivers' worries about running out of battery charge. Tesla's updated software will map out the best route to a driver's destination based on the location of charging stations.
